No. 1 UNC Men's Golf Finishes One Stroke Back At Ben Hogan Collegiate Invitational


UNC's final-round 10-under-par 270 was the lowest score of the day but No. 2 Vanderbilt made two birdies on the final hole of the tournament to edge the Tar Heels by one stroke in the Ben Hogan Collegiate Invitational Tuesday at Shady Oaks Country Club in Westworth Village, Texas. led the No. 1 Tar Heels with a 5-under 65 Tuesday.
